Hi. I am a physics teacher and i am new in Algodoo. So, could you help me to simule below question, please. Thanks a lot.
Suppose I have two identical masses, m1 and m2, that are both sliding along a frictionless horizontal surface with the same speed and direction. When they reach point A, m1 continues as before, but m2 drops into a depression in the surface. I'm not specifying anything about the shape of this depression except that it is smooth and continuous, and it does not drop so suddenly that m2 loses contact with it - in other words, gravity is sufficient to keep m2 on the surface (no cliffs or walls). Which mass will arrive at point B first?
